## Fan-out backpressure (Pingwick notifier)

Quick context for the security review: when a broadcast event hits Pingwick, we fan out to per-device queues. If downstream push gateways slow down, we shed load by pausing the fan-out workers rather than dropping silently — dropped notifications were a phishing vector in the old Hartlev stack, since retries went through an unauthenticated side channel. The pause thresholds are deliberately conservative. The constants we tune during incident response are listed below.

tuning constants:
QUOTAS = {
    "druwyn": 5,
    "holix": 5,
    "zorath": 5,
    "holwyn": 10,
}

**Q: How do the canary gating rules work for Thistledown deploys?** A canary receives 5% of traffic for 30 minutes. Promotion is blocked if error rate exceeds 0.5% over baseline, p99 latency regresses more than 10%, or any alarm in the "canary-critical" group fires. Overrides require two approvals and are logged to the audit stream. Gating thresholds live in the deploy manifest, not the dashboard — edit them there. If the gating service's sealed config store needs unlocking, use the recovery passphrase directly below:

strongbox words: prawyn-fenmir

**Runbook: Recovering your Memloupe plugin account**

If you've lost access to your Memloupe developer account, your signed plugins will keep profiling GPU allocations just fine, but you won't be able to push updates to the registry. Don't create a duplicate account — it orphans your plugin namespace and support will grumble. Instead, use the self-service recovery flow from the publisher console. When prompted, you'll need the recovery passphrase issued at signup. For convenience during onboarding, we record it here.

unlock words, fafop-hawep: briwyn-oliix-sorox

Welcome to the Quillhaven order platform. Soft deletes mark rows with a deleted-at timestamp rather than removing them, so every migration touching the orders table must ship through the attested Lanternside build pipeline — hand-applied schema changes break our provenance chain. Each migration artifact is signed at build time and verified before apply. When reviewing a deploy, confirm the signature matches the pipeline record. The provenance token for the current schema build is recorded below.

trace token, tawep-fahif: htk3_b58